Recycling is a program where Boy Scouts from troops 105, 101, and 102 help out at the Hanover Borough Recycling Center. The scouts unload the vehicles that drive in and place the recyclables in the proper areas. They are able to take the following items: newspapers/phone books, cardboard, aluminum, tin, and glass.
Recycling is held every 2nd Saturday 8 a.m. - 4 p.m. and every 4th Saturday 8 a.m. -12 p.m., no matter what the weather conditions are.
Recycling helps by earning the troops money to use towards scouting purposes. The money that Troop 105 receives gets split up between member's individual accounts. Each boy in the troop can then use his money to pay for troop outings and camping equipment.
